The historic market town of Skipton is known as the 'Gateway to the Dales'; with beautiful open countryside and rural villages to explore surrounding it. The business centres of Leeds and Manchester are within comfortable daily commuting distance and direct trains to London's Kings Cross as well as Leeds, Bradford and the Settle to Carlisle line, run regularly. Skipton offers a wide range of amenities including well renowned schools, restaurants and High Street shopping brands as well as a diverse range of private retailers and regular markets.

TENURE
The property is a park home and is subject to the Mobile Homes Act. Useful information can be found at:
Upon the sale of a park home the occupying vendors pays a percentage of the sale price to the park owners. The current rate for Overdale Park is 9% of the agreed sale price. This rate is set by the Secretary of State and is currently capped at a maximum of 10%.
